Physical changes occur when a substance undergoes a transformation without altering its chemical composition. This means that the substance remains the same chemically, but its physical properties change. For example, when ice melts, it changes from a solid to a liquid, but its chemical composition remains the same. This fundamental concept is crucial to understanding various chemical processes and phenomena.

Physical changes occur without altering the chemical composition of a substance, whereas chemical changes involve a transformation of the substance's chemical composition.
